Transaction 13686c37be31397771c97f7f947a36618e7e67fdab096e239149eb7a56ca26a4

2 Input
2 Outputs
  • 13686c37be31397771c97f7f947a36618e7e67fdab096e239149eb7a56ca26a4:0
  • value  7430274
    address  34RGiAkUnTFuJyGnorPGeBaHWZjDwXbcs6
  • 13686c37be31397771c97f7f947a36618e7e67fdab096e239149eb7a56ca26a4:1
  • value  8360393
    address  15yKL9HcsrKH6s5QxK8t72mgc24UKNgWhR